LED Under-Unit Lighting
Installing LED lights under your wall units goes a long way toward giving your home a luxurious, high-end look. Subtle lighting enhances glass pieces, specialty dishware, and décor displayed on your built-in shelves. For kitchen wall units with glass doors, LED lighting beautifully highlights your specialty dishes for the holidays. In kitchen renovations, built-in wall units with LED accents are especially popular — a darker countertop like Black Galaxy pairs elegantly with off-white or brilliant white cabinetry lit from below.
Materials for Custom Wall Units & Built-Ins
When building your custom wall units and built-ins, there are many high-quality material options to choose from:
- Solid wood — solid maple or 100% natural walnut with rich, natural grain and texture, stained or painted to the highest standards
- Thermofoil MDF — greatly improved in quality, easy to maintain, eye-catching, and available in a wide range of customizable textures and finishes
- High-gloss & semi-gloss doors — available in beautiful patterns and bold or neutral colours
- Hand-painted finishes — applied to the highest professional standards for a truly bespoke result
- Glass door inserts — from plain to stained to rain-down glass, paired with a wide selection of handles for a classic, polished look
